Really nice spot, but hard to get there w/ a big vehicle
My husband and I took our Chevy G 10 van and we had plenty of space to park, plenty of privacy, and access to a bathroom. However, the road to get here was a little bit treacherous for a vehicle so big. RVs beware
Peaceful and simple
Small campground, quiet. Easily accessible. Bring everything you need including water. Love this place :)

Directions
Directions: From I-81: Take exit 279. Turn west on SR 675. Drive 3.5 miles to STOP sign at VA 42. Turn right, and take next left to continue on SR 675. Drive 3.1 miles to a fork in the road. Stay right, on SR 675, and drive another 3.4 miles to the top of the mountain. The entrance is on your right.
